Judge Halts Revival Of L’Oreal Lipstick Class Action
Ruth Koronthaly of South Orange, N.J., filed the initial class action complaint against L’Oreal and its distributor Proctor & Gamble Distributing LLC in 2007 in the U.S. District Court of New Jersey after the Campaign for Safe Cosmetics published a report indicating that some of the company's lipsticks contained dangerous levels of lead.
